realized this week that about 600 people in this town, which has about 3000 people total, are members of the church,.. our branch has a steady attendance of 15.. its crazy to see how many people fell away.. it makes it hard to work because this town is so small,everyone knows how the church had a huge fall in attendance and stuff so the church has a bad rep here... makes things a little more interesting! haha
